Mashed Zucchini

Ready In: 45 mins

Serves: 3

Ingredients

  • 1  lb zucchini (use any combination of yellow, green, or whatever you can find)
  • 2  tablespoons  powdered nonfat dry creamer
  • 12 tablespoon light butter
  • 1  tablespoon  grated parmesan cheese
  • 1  teaspoon  mixed Italian herbs

Directions

  1. Cut the zucchinis in 1-inch chunks, put them in a pot, cover with water and boil over medium heat.
  2. Once the zucchinis are very tender (around 15 min), drain them and put them back in the pot. Return the pot to the heat and start mashing them (you can do that with a fork or a potato masher), some water will get out of them, boil them for few minutes until the water evaporates.
  3. Add the rest of the ingredients and stir.
  4. You can be creative and add other flavorings such as garlic or other spices.
